Bernhard Burgin

In a context where software performs numeric calculations on the basis of incomplete or contradictory data, the end user might want to see not only the calculated results, but also information about the quality of the results. The Value with Quality pattern bundles a value together with its quality, and automates the propagation of quality to dependent results.

2000
Ruben Gamboa

This case study shows how ACL2 can be used to reason about the real and complex numbers, using non-standard analysis. It describes some modifications to ACL2 that include the irrational real and complex numbers in ACL2’s numeric system. It then shows how the modified ACL2 can prove classic theorems of analysis, such as the intermediate-value and mean-value theorems.
